Fettuccine Alfredo with Asparagus

From Food & Wine

Serves: 4


⢠1 pound(s) asparagus

⢠3/4 pound(s) fettuccine

⢠4 tablespoon(s) butter, cut into pieces

⢠1 cup(s) heavy cream

⢠1 pinch(s) grated nutmeg

⢠3/4 teaspoon(s) salt

⢠1/8 teaspoon(s) fresh-ground black pepper

⢠1/2 cup(s) grated Parmesan cheese, plus more for serving

Directions

1. Snap the tough ends off the asparagus and discard them. Cut the asparagus spears into 1-inch pieces. In a large pot of boiling, salted water, cook the fettuccine until almost done, about 8 minutes. Add the asparagus; cook until it and the pasta are just done, about 4 minutes longer.

2. Drain the pasta and asparagus. Toss with the butter, cream, nutmeg, salt, pepper and Parmesan. Serve with additional Parmesan.
